A waiver service provider is an occupation that involves assisting individuals with disabilities in accessing and utilizing services and supports. They work closely with clients and their families to identify needs, develop plans, and coordinate services to ensure the best possible outcomes. Waiver service providers may help with tasks such as personal care, transportation, housing, employment, and social activities. They also play a crucial role in advocating for the rights and inclusion of individuals with disabilities within their communities.

Waiver Service Provider salary in Ireland
Average Yearly Salary of Waiver Service Provider in Ireland is approximately 50,435 EUR (50,195 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
